Output 73e6560418f44168613f50760e96be47ec9918d27eb2f9fe321ecac6a2c913a4:0

value
2630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4005796097ff190df3eb0779188b758aa9964711 OP_EQUAL
address
37XXjApaPmTiU5rVSqUHj4ZTuqL7VEZfQW
transaction
73e6560418f44168613f50760e96be47ec9918d27eb2f9fe321ecac6a2c913a4
spent
true